Lions Clubs International has over 1,375,351 members in 45,663 clubs in 753 districts and 205 countries. Clubs annually carry out over thousands of service projects benefiting communities around the world. 

The Roswell Lions Club has 51 active men and women. We currently meet the third Monday of the month (except July and August) @7:00p.m. at the new Holiday Inn on Holcomb Bridge Road near the Olive Garden.

The Roswell Lions are twinned with the Vancouver South Lions Club in MD-19A in British Columbia, Canada.

Annual Apple Sale Fundraiser - Coming Soon!

 

Mutsu (Crispin) - A sweet tart apple. Holds shape well. Especially good for pies, baking apples, and applesauce.

 Mutsu apple

Fuji - An all-purpose cross between Red Delicious and Ralls Janet. Aromatic with a sweet tart flavor, crisp and juicy even after storage. Good eating apple.

 Fuji apple

Granny Smith - A good all-purpose, tart eating and cooking apple. Makes delicious applesauce.

Granny Smith apple

Red Delicious - Crisp and sweet eating apple.

Red Delicious apple

Golden Delicious - Holds shape well and are especially good for pies and baked apples. Also good for slaws and sauces.

Fly The Flag Program      Next Holiday - Monday, September 6th, Labor Day

Join the Roswell Lions Club as we work to return old-fashioned American Patriotism to our community. We are offering a "Fly the Flag" program as a service to you and the community. We will support your efforts to fly the American flag on seven of the most important national holidays each year. The Roswell Lions Club will install the display hardware at your direction and each holiday a member of our club will put up the flag, take it down and store it until the next designated holiday. When you display the flag you are letting the public know that you care and together our efforts will confirm to everyone that we believe in America and support its traditions and freedoms. The eight holidays are: President's Day/February, Memorial Day/May, Flag Day/June, Independence Day/July, Labor Day/September, September 11th, Columbus Day/October and Veterans Day/November. 23rd Annual Lions International Peace Poster Contest

The theme for the 2011 contest is "The Vision of Peace".  In the past we have sponsored contests at Elkins Pointe Middle School,  Crabapple Middle School, The Cottage School and Queen of Angels Catholic School. Posters will be judged at the beginning of November. This contest is for boys and girls ages 11 - 13 years old. The winners of the 2011 contest will each received a $100 check and will be honored at a dinner meeting. One poster from each contest will advance to the District 18-A Contest.
